Summary of Employees' Settlement in The golden state
Workers' payment in The golden state is made to support employees who experience occupational injuries or illnesses. This system provides benefits that can assist employees spend for clinical expenditures and shed wages, ensuring they receive required care and support during healing.
History and Function
The workers' payment system in California began in the early 20th century. It aimed to offer a fair way to work out work environment injury insurance claims without the demand for suits. Before this system, hurt workers dealt with lots of obstacles in getting settlement.
The regulation was developed to protect both employees and companies. It permits employees to get timely benefits while restricting employers' liability. This approach urges secure working environments and promotes sector requirements that prioritize employee security.
Scope and Insurance coverage
The golden state law covers most staff members, consisting of permanent, part-time, and seasonal workers. The requirements for protection can vary based upon the kind of employer and the nature of the job.
Employees have to report injuries within a certain timespan to get benefits. Covered injuries typically consist of accidents, repetitive strain disorder, and occupational conditions. Benefits may include clinical treatment, short-lived impairment settlements, and job re-training, which help workers go back to work as soon as possible.
Qualification and Cases Process
To get employees' compensation in California, it is necessary to know who is eligible and just how to properly sue. The process has clear steps that workers need to comply with to guarantee they obtain the benefits they are worthy of.
Figuring out Qualification
To get employees' compensation, a worker should satisfy specific requirements. First, the person needs to be a worker, not an independent service provider. This consists of both permanent and part-time employees.
On top of that, the injury has to have taken place while executing occupational jobs. This indicates that if an employee is harmed while doing something for their job, they are generally eligible. Injuries can be physical or psychological.
Last but not least, the company needs to have workers' compensation insurance. Most companies in California are needed to carry this coverage. If an employee is not sure regarding their eligibility, they can consult with a legal expert to obtain recommendations.
Filing a Claim
The case declaring process begins with the worker alerting their employer about the injury. This notification ought to be done asap, preferably within thirty days of the injury.
After alerting the employer, the worker has to fill in an insurance claim form referred to as DWC 1. This form gathers details regarding the injury and have to be submitted to the employer within one year from the day of injury.
Once the company obtains the insurance claim, they have 2 week to respond. If they accept the case, benefits will start. If they deny it, the worker can appeal the decision. Maintaining detailed records of all interactions and files is critical.

Advantages and Payment
Workers' compensation in The golden state gives necessary advantages to workers who are wounded on duty. Secret benefits consist of medical therapy expenses, handicap benefits, and additional work variation support.
Medical Treatment Prices
Medical therapy expenses are covered for employees that experience job-related injuries. This consists of needed medical care such as medical professional sees, healthcare facility stays, surgical procedures, and rehabilitation. Wounded workers can pick their medical provider from a listing given by their employer or via the state's employees' payment insurance policy.
Workers need to report their injury promptly to get these advantages. The insurance company commonly pays the clinical bills directly. This aids guarantee that damaged employees receive timely treatment without included economic tension.
Special needs Advantages
Disability benefits sustain employees that can not perform their task because of injury. The golden state gives 2 kinds: short-term and long-term special needs advantages.
Short-lived handicap helps employees who are unable to work for a limited time. They get regarding two-thirds of their typical regular earnings, topped at a state-defined maximum amount.
Long-term special needs advantages are offered to those who have long lasting effects from their injuries. The amount is based on the severity of the disability and the employee's earning ability. This protection aids workers in taking care of economic commitments while recuperating.
Supplemental Task Displacement
Supplemental work displacement benefits are readily available to employees not able to return to their previous work because of an injury. If a worker certifies, they get a voucher to make use of for re-training or education.
The worth of the voucher can differ according to the injury's scenarios. This choice permits injured employees to discover brand-new skills and look for different employment opportunities. It is essential for those seeking to transition back right into the labor force.
These benefits aid hurt staff members restore their ground and maintain financial security after a job-related injury.
Legal Structure and Dispute Resolution
Employees' compensation in California is controlled by a specific collection of rules and guidelines. Recognizing these laws and the process for resolving conflicts is crucial for both employees and employers. This area covers state laws and the appeals process involved in workers' payment cases.
State Rules
California's workers' payment system is largely controlled by the Labor Code. This code describes the legal rights of hurt workers and the obligations of companies.
Crucial element consist of:
- Mandatory Insurance coverage: The majority of companies have to lug employees' settlement insurance policy.
- Advantage Kind: Harmed employees may receive medical care, impairment payments, and employment rehab.
- Insurance claims Process: Workers should report injuries quickly and file claims within a particular timeframe.
The Department of Employees' Compensation (DWC) oversees these regulations. It additionally supplies info and support to those associated with the system. Recognizing these guidelines helps people navigate their rights and duties successfully.
Appeals Process
If an employee disagrees with a choice regarding their case, they can appeal. The charms procedure in California employees' payment involves numerous steps.
- Request for Hearing: A worker can file an ask for a hearing with the Workers' Settlement Appeals Board (WCAB).
- Hearing: A judge will certainly conduct a hearing where both events can present proof.
- Choice: After the hearing, the judge concerns a decision that can be appealed additionally if necessary.
It is vital for workers to gather all pertinent documentation and evidence prior to appealing. This prep work can substantially influence the outcome of their instance.
